refactor(auth.service): remove unused imports and variables
Some checks failed
CI / Get Changed Files (pull_request) Successful in 10s
CI / Checkstyle Main (pull_request) Has been skipped
CI / Docker backend validation (pull_request) Successful in 14s
CI / oxlint (pull_request) Successful in 26s
CI / eslint (pull_request) Successful in 34s
CI / Docker frontend validation (pull_request) Successful in 47s
CI / prettier (pull_request) Failing after 23s
CI / test-build (pull_request) Successful in 32s

This commit is contained in:
Constantin Simonis 2025-05-07 17:24:32 +02:00
commit db6bf4f199
No known key found for this signature in database
GPG key ID: 3878FF77C24AF4D2

View file

@ -1,6 +1,6 @@
import { Injectable } from '@angular/core'; import { Injectable } from '@angular/core';
import { HttpClient } from '@angular/common/http'; import { HttpClient } from '@angular/common/http';
import { BehaviorSubject, catchError, EMPTY, Observable, tap } from 'rxjs'; import { BehaviorSubject, Observable, tap } from 'rxjs';
import { Router } from '@angular/router'; import { Router } from '@angular/router';
import { LoginRequest } from '../model/auth/LoginRequest'; import { LoginRequest } from '../model/auth/LoginRequest';
import { RegisterRequest } from '../model/auth/RegisterRequest'; import { RegisterRequest } from '../model/auth/RegisterRequest';
@ -19,14 +19,12 @@ export class AuthService {
private userUrl = `${environment.apiUrl}/users`; private userUrl = `${environment.apiUrl}/users`;
userSubject: BehaviorSubject<User | null>; userSubject: BehaviorSubject<User | null>;
public currentUser: Observable<User | null>;
constructor( constructor(
private http: HttpClient, private http: HttpClient,
private router: Router private router: Router
) { ) {
this.userSubject = new BehaviorSubject<User | null>(this.getUserFromStorage()); this.userSubject = new BehaviorSubject<User | null>(this.getUserFromStorage());
this.currentUser = this.userSubject.asObservable().pipe(catchError(() => EMPTY));
if (this.getToken()) { if (this.getToken()) {
this.loadCurrentUser(); this.loadCurrentUser();